Boniface Excluded from Leverkusen's Europa League Squad

Super Eagles striker Victor Boniface has been omitted from Bayer Leverkusen’s squad for the 2026/27 UEFA Europa League campaign, as confirmed by head coach Carles Martinez. The decision stems from concerns regarding Boniface's physical condition, which has been affected by previous fitness setbacks and injuries.
Martinez emphasized that the exclusion is based on Boniface's current fitness level rather than his significance to the team. The manager expressed hope that Boniface will recover fully and be available for selection later in the competition.
The club aims to manage his recovery carefully to prevent further setbacks, as Boniface's game relies heavily on strength and physicality. His absence does not imply he will miss the entire tournament, as Leverkusen remains optimistic about his potential return during the season.
Boniface's fitness is also crucial for the Super Eagles, given the upcoming busy international calendar.
